Glutamate-induced long-term potentiation of the frequency of miniature synaptic currents in cultured hippocampal neurons

Explore this paper's citation graph

Summary

The sustained potentiation of mini frequency is expressed even in the absence of Ca2+ entry into presynaptic terminals, and postsynaptic induction can lead to enhancement of Presynaptic transmitter release.
